Enter the finger skateboard skatepark – a miniature world of ramps, rails, and obstacles where finger skateboarders can practice their tricks and show off their skills. These skateparks are typically made from various materials such as wood, plastic, or metal, and can be customized to suit each individual’s preferences and skill level.
The beauty of finger skateboard skateparks lies in their versatility and creativity. From simple ramps and grind rails to complex multi-level structures, there is no limit to the types of obstacles that can be incorporated into a finger skatepark. This allows skaters to constantly challenge themselves and improve their skills in a fun and interactive way.
Setting up a finger skateboard skatepark is relatively easy and can be done with just a few basic tools and materials. DIY enthusiasts can get creative and build their own skatepark from scratch, while others may choose to purchase a pre-made kit or set of obstacles to assemble at home.
